WebDiscrete mean estimates and the Landau-Siegel zero Yitang Zhang Abstract Let ˜be a real primitive character to the modulus D. It is proved that L(1;˜) ˛(logD) 2024 where the implied constant is absolute and e ectively computable. WebNov 5, 2024 · There will be many important consequences of Zhang's result, if correct. One specific result is that it will reduce one of the last open problem from the era of Gauss and Euler to a finite amount of computation, namely the classification of discriminants of binary quadratic forms with one class per genus. richmond hill activityWebThe Landau-Siegel zero and spacing of zeros of \(L\)-functions ...
